  "body": "Stephen Holland, Johan Fynbo, Bjarne Thomsen (University of Aarhus),\nMichael Andersen (University of Oulu),\nGunnlaugur Bjornsson (University of Iceland),\nJens Hjorth (University of Copenhagen),\nAndreas Jaunsen (University of Oslo),\nPriya Natarajan (Universities of Cambridge, & Yale), and\nNial Tanvir (University of Hertfordshire)\n\n\tWe have obtained 8224 seconds of STIS images with the F28X50LP\n(long pass) aperture of the host galaxy of GRB 990123.  This data was\ntaken as part of the Survey of the Host Galaxies of Gamma-Ray Bursts\n(Holland et al. GCN 698) approximately 509 days after the burst.\nCombined images are now available at\n\"http://www.ifa.au.dk/~hst/grb_hosts/data/index.html\".\n\n\tUsing the light curve fits of Holland et al. (2000, submitted\nto A&A) we predict that the optical afterglow will have R = 31.6 on 15\nJune 2000, and thus will not be visible in the STIS images.\nTherefore, we used aperture photometry to determine the AB magnitudes,\nin the long pass filter, of the three knots found by Holland & Hjorth\n(1999, A&A, 344, L67).  We find the following colours for the three\nextended knots where CL is the AB magnitude in the STIS clear\naperture, LP is the AB magnitude in the STIS long pass aperture, and\nbeta is the corresponding spectral index, f = k*nu^beta.\n\nKnot   CL     LP         CL-LP       beta\n  1   28.3   28.2    +0.1 +/- 0.4    -0.4\n  2   28.1   27.5    +0.6 +/- 0.4    -2.6\n  3   28.0   27.5    +0.5 +/- 0.4    -2.2\n\n       The GRB occurred on the southeast edge of Knot 1.  This knot is\napproximately one sigma bluer than the other two knots, and two sigma\nbluer than the overall colour of the galaxy (V-R = 0.43 +/- 0.18;\nCastro-Tirado et al., 1999, Science 283, 2069).  This suggests that\nKnot 1 might be undergoing stronger star formation than the rest of\nthe galaxy.",
